I went to FL with the family for a weeks vacation. Threw my Tesoro Vaquero in the back of the SUV in case I had a spare minute to detect. I only got to go out hunting one night for about an hour and a half on the beach behind our condos. No good finds, only found bottle caps, tent stakes, aluminum cans, a lighter, and one modern penny.

Here's the crazy part. The next day, the family and I were walking out to the beach just to lay out in the sun and play in the ocean. I'm walking along with our beach bag, and see a quarter just laying there on the boardwalk that goes from the condo to the beach. I pick it up, and my jaw hit the floor. It was a 1906 Barber quarter with New Orleans mint mark in great condition. I have no idea how it got there, but it was a surprise for sure. I found nothing while using the metal detector, then I find a nice old coin while just strolling out to the beach.
